What is the 7 day notice in Nebraska?
Once the tenant receives a 7-day notice, the tenant has 7 days from the date of the notice to pay the rent in full, including any late fees which may apply. If the tenant presents the rent in full (including late fees) during those seven days, the landlord MUST accept the rent.

What happens if you dont publish your LLC in Nebraska?
There are no specific penalties for failure to file a publication notice. But, for corporations and LLCs, filing a publication notice is a requirement under Nebraska law and failure to do so could negatively affect your business. Its safest for your business to file your publication notice as soon as possible.
